Einzelnen Beitrag anzeigen

alzaimar
(Moderator)

Registriert seit: 6. Mai 2005
Ort: Berlin
4.956 Beiträge
 
Delphi 2007 Enterprise
 
#1

Delphi-DLL mit String-Var-Parametern von VB aus aufrufen

  Alt 22. Feb 2006, 10:32
Ahoi!

Einfache Geschichte: Ich hab eine Delphi-Prozedur:
Procedure DoSomething (Var aParameter : String); Darum eine DLL und so deklarieren, das sie von VB aus ansprechbar ist. Nun hab ich kein VB, sonst würd ich da schon was finden, denn ich weiss schon, das ich den String als PChar und die Prozedur als stdCall deklarieren muss.

Procedure DLLWrapperDoSomething (aParameter : PChar); stdCall; Damit ist aber der aParameter noch kein 'Var' Parameter.

Reicht dann etwa ein
Procedure DLLWrapperDoSomething (Var aParameter : PChar); stdCall;
"Wenn ist das Nunstruck git und Slotermeyer? Ja! Beiherhund das Oder die Flipperwaldt gersput!"
(Monty Python "Joke Warefare")
  Mit Zitat antworten Zitat